lib/danger/ci_source/jenkins.rb in danger-8.2.3 vs lib/danger/ci_source/jenkins.rb in danger-8.3.1

- old
+ new

@@ -131,10 +131,10 @@ case change_url when %r{\/pull\/} # GitHub matches = change_url.match(%r{(.+)\/pull\/[0-9]+}) matches[1] unless matches.nil? when %r{\/merge_requests\/} # GitLab - matches = change_url.match(%r{(.+)\/merge_requests\/[0-9]+}) + matches = change_url.match(%r{(.+?)(\/-)?\/merge_requests\/[0-9]+}) matches[1] unless matches.nil? when %r{\/pull-requests\/} # Bitbucket matches = change_url.match(%r{(.+)\/pull-requests\/[0-9]+}) matches[1] unless matches.nil? else